Transaction fdbbaeaba62816a4de306993a5414545c66ddffd1f3440e5dfd96b3656beeda1
1 Input
1 Output
-
fdbbaeaba62816a4de306993a5414545c66ddffd1f3440e5dfd96b3656beeda1:0
- value
- 686400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 19d4fcc9bf2a3e46f73a31bda131f1691322e7ea OP_EQUALVERIFY OP_CHECKSIG
- address
- 13Mb3RZXJ3na3y6jf1e9b9Bq3hGUnED7ft